Several critical factors underpin the rising importance of Biopharmaceutical Analytical Testing. First, the increasing prevalence of chronic illnesses necessitates the development of innovative therapeutics, amplifying the need for precise testing services that ensure drug safety and effectiveness. This demand is further fueled by a shift toward personalized medicine, where tailored therapeutic approaches require specific testing solutions. Advanced ADME toxicology testing services are becoming crucial in this regard, as they help ascertain the absorption, distribution, metabolism, and excretion patterns of new drugs. Furthermore, regulatory bodies are becoming more stringent in their requirements for clinical trial bioanalytical testing, mandating adherence to GLP principles. This regulatory scrutiny is shaping operational strategies within pharmaceutical companies, urging them to invest in compliant testing frameworks. Organizations that prioritize regulatory adherence while innovating their testing methodologies will likely thrive in this competitive landscape.

What are biopharmaceutical analytical testing services?
Biopharmaceutical analytical testing services encompass a suite of methodologies aimed at evaluating the safety and efficacy of therapeutic agents. These services include pharmaceutical bioanalysis, ADME toxicology testing, and clinical trial bioanalytical testing, which ensure that new drugs meet regulatory standards and perform effectively in clinical settings.
How do regulatory requirements influence biopharmaceutical analytical testing?
Regulatory requirements play a critical role in shaping biopharmaceutical analytical testing by establishing standards that these services must adhere to. Compliance with Good Laboratory Practices (GLP) is essential, as it ensures the reliability of testing outcomes and fosters trust in the drug development process. Companies must continuously adapt their practices to meet evolving regulatory landscapes, which influences their operational strategies and investments.
